The BAOFENG BF-888S Walkie Talkies are a robust communication solution designed for both personal and professional use. With a long-range capability of up to 3 miles, 16 channels for versatile communication, and an impressive battery life of up to 96 hours, these walkie talkies are perfect for various environments, from construction sites to outdoor adventures. The durable, rainproof design ensures they can withstand the elements, while comprehensive after-sales support provides added assurance.

W**M
Baofeng 888s radios
Batteries will not snap into slots with belt clips on must loosen belt clip screws insert battery then tighten screws or leave belt clips off. Batteries still not wanting to go into slots easily. If battery left in radio and recharged when needed then belt clips can stay on but not able to switch out battery in the field without small screwdriver. Inconvenient but so far radios work ok. Would rather carry second fully charged radio than mess with battery change.
